Well, I must be the dissenter. I got one.

I had the NR Auto / CincySHO white gauge faces, liked it with the black stock gauge panel. I put the Speedhut aluminum panel on there, & to me it looked like BUTT.

The idiot light holes are too small - I have a "hec ngin" light. The directional indicator also was cut off a bit. I was going to pull it off once I got home from Carlisle, but I don't have to worry about it now. :)

I agree with Fred. My friend just got the overlay, and the spots are too small. The needles on the fuel actually hit the aluminum overlay, and stick. Also, In my opinion it looks kinda out of place (weird color).
